Webwhere h is height above sea level and R is the Earth radius . The expression can be simplified as: where the constant equals k = 3.57 km/m½ = 1.22 mi/ft½ . In this equation, Earth's surface is assumed to be … shanghai palace rutherglenWebThe earth curvature and refraction corrections are applied to vertical angle observations and therefore have an impact on computed vertical distance values. They also affect the horizontal distance values to a very small extent. The earth curvature and refraction corrections can be applied independently using the options provided. shanghai palace liverpoolWebApr 7, 2024 · The reflective spectrum was 400–700 nm, and the incident angle was 0°–30°.
